Apple Mac Studio M4 Max Review: A Creative Powerhouse

Mac Studio is the final performance computers of Apple, however This year model It came with an evolution: It is equipped with either the M4 Max processor or the M3 Ultra processor. The last may seem to be a step back, because almost all Mac devices (except Mac Pro) now Equipped M4 chips. However, the M3 Ultra is actually the best performance Apple processor, making the new Mac Studio the fastest computer ever.

Although the M3 Ultra looks very capable of creative positives and engineers, it starts from $ 4000 and goes road Even from there. I am fascinated by this model based on the criteria that I saw elsewhere, of course. However, the M4 Max that you received for this review is the model that most people want, as the basic composition is half the price. For energy users who do tasks such as video editing or game design, it is a favorite Mac, and even is a decent deal according to Apple standards.

Mac Studio’s design has not changed since the original M1 Ultra from 2022. This is not a bad thing because aesthetic has been well enacted and takes a very small office space. It is the size of two old Mac Minis (before the last update that Make them smallerClassted together and has the same polished aluminum condition. Everything has a distinct feeling, even an environmentally friendly package and elastic energy cable.

In the foreground, there is a SDXC card that supports UH-II speeds (300MB/s), along with a pair of USB-C 10 GB ports (Thunderbolt 5 on the M3 Ultra version). Throughout the back, you will find four Thunderbolt 5 ports that now provide productivity of up to 15 GB/s (capital B), three times at Mac 2023 studio speeds with Thunderbolt 4. All this is enough to connect a lot of drives, screens and peripheral devices.

Inside, the M3 Ultra version is exaggerated with the CPU up to 32 nucleus, eight more than Mac Studio M2 Ultra. The graphics processing unit comes with 80 lights, and another Apple record, along with a 32 -light nerve engine on the device and machine learning. The uniform memory starts from 96 GB and up to 512 GB (with up to 819 GB/s from the domain width) and 16 TB of SSD storage. With all these elements, the MAC studio costs hair breeding 14,099 dollars.

M4 Max model is more modest but still impressive. The higher configuration with the CPU with 16 cores and GPU 40 nucleus, over 546 GB/second of the frequency range of uniform memory and up to 8 terabytes of storage. These specifications are closely consistent with MacBook Pro M4 Max, but at a lower price, by the way. At the basis price of $ 1999, you can get the 14 -core CPU, 32 nucleus and 16 -core engine. All M4 Max models start with a 36 GB uniform, although my test unit came up with a maximum of 128 GB in the formation of $ 3,699.

The processor, memory, and storage cannot be upgraded after purchase, so you will want to choose wisely upon request. This challenges itself, because Apple is not very flexible with system formations. For example, the M4 Mac MAX MAX studio of $ 1,999 cannot be formed with only $ 1999 with 36 GB RAM. If you want more, you need the 16 -core version that is automatically colliding up to 48 GB and adds $ 500 to the price.

I would like to say that the last option is the sweet spot at a price of $ 2499, which includes the fastest processor and sufficient memory for most content creation. Engineers and others who are looking for more performance may want the M3 Ultra version, allowing up to 512 GB of RAM and putting two additional holes in the front.

Mac studio with M4 Max destroyed most of the artificial standards, indicating the highest degree of Geekbench CPU 6 for any computer we tested. It is located below the Mac Studio directly with the M2 Ultra in the Geekbench Multicore 6 test. It even surpasses the latest Mac Studio M3 Ultra in mono -core performance, although this model is led in multiple tests. GPU results are likely impressive, and the productivity of Atto’s peak is the best we have seen so far with writing speeds of 8 GB/s.

However, the best way to evaluate a machine like this is to feed it with some content creation functions and know how quickly it is chewed through it. Video editing is the most common test for most machines, so I tried Premiere Pro and Davinci Resolution with a mixture of 4K, 6K, 8K (RAW and MP4) video to challenge it.

All of these files are easily played in their original formats without any vags on a 4K timetable, thanks to the M4 Max’s capacity To decode RAW and 10 -bit H.264 or H.265 files on flying. He was still able to handle the actual time of one layer of 8K video with the addition of color correction and only struggled when you tried to play 8K or more video tracks at the same time. In general, it provides a smooth and imbalanced editing experience that enables energy users to complete the work quickly.

Fast coding is so much. It took me one minute and 51 seconds to take out a 3.5 -minute schedule in 4K with the same mixture of 4K, 6K and 8K shots using GPU. For comparison, MacBook Pro took more with M3 Pro processor more than twice in four minutes and 10 seconds.

The Mac Studio showed the same ingenuity with Lightroom Classic and Photoshop, which quickly provides the means of raw images that were 100MB or larger. Note that when doing the intense GPU-CPU tasks like video coding, the fan will start and can become the structure warm, but this did not happen much. However, the largest Mac Studio size and the largest fan provides better thermal performance than Mac Mini.

To test the possibilities of artificial intelligence in the device, you have run a 75 -minute podcast through the Apple Whisper version and it took a minute and 32 seconds to convert it into a text. It took MacBook Pro with the M4 Pro processor two minutes and 11 seconds for the same task, and did MacBook Pro M3 Pro in three minutes and thirty -seven seconds.

In addition to creating content, played The third floor portalThe game that places moderate demands on a computer. The Mac Studio was up to the mission, as he presented smooth play in high settings and 1440 pixels (although it was somewhat limited to the 60 Hz anemia update in a studio). I noticed that Mac Studio became somewhat hot and that the fans kicked during gaming sessions. However, GPU’s performance exceeded most computers except for those with high -end graphics processing units, based on a quick comparison with our recent tests and Geekbench database. To this end, the only thing that limits Mac studio as a game machine is the scattered option for MacOS games.

The content of the content may wonder if they need to be boasting of the Mac Studio, or if the Mac Mini will do the task. After all, you can get Mac Mini M4 Pro with 24 GB RAM for $ 1,399 instead of Mac Studio M4 Max and give up Thunderbolt 5 and 12 GB of uniform memory, providing $ 600.

If you edit 4K videos (or higher) regularly, provide 3D graphics (or play games), you will be better with Mac Studio. For less required jobs, Mac Mini is likely enough. Mac Studio M3 Ultra is another completely animal, with additional cores and a higher memory capacity aimed at engineers or artificial intelligence developers. At 4000 dollars, it is often exaggerated for everyone. Mac Pro is also there, but it is so expensive that it is really for studios and large companies, which means that Mac Studio is now the upscale Mac for most professionals.
